I'm working with a few functions (e.g. do.base.descriptions in the
netstat package) that, in addition to returning an object with
variables I want to extract, also print output.  There is no way to
turn this default printing behavior off in many of the functions.

Is there a blanket way to suppress such printing, say, within a loop
or a ddply statement?

?capture.output
?sink
